Magath could be without Mark van Bommel on Tuesday when they play their first home league game of the year. The Dutch international midfielder has an Achilles problem and missed training on Sunday.

That could mean a return to the starting line-up for Owen Hargreaves, the England midfielder who has not played since September after breaking his leg.

Midfielder Ali Karimi is also a fitness doubt and that could see Magath opt to recall Lukas Podolski and play three up front for a match Bayern must win.

Yes it's the 3-5-2 they've been talking about at the start of the season before Ismael got injured. Magath spoke about it as well now that Ismael is close to a comeback. In my opinion, we can start using it without waiting for Ismael. Lahm and Sagnol are better going forward than defending, so reducing their defensive duties will allow them to play better. We can have Hargreaves in his ideal holding role, Van Bommel in his ideal central midfield position... a bit to the right aiding Sagnol, and Schweinsteiger in an attacking midfield position... a bit to the left aiding Lahm and Podolski, with which he has a great partnership. Also, this way, when one defender goes up to attack, there's still 2 central defenders at the back. I think the formation makes the best use of each and every single player that we have.
